Output 89b4e7c45ca8c161d9b7ed631d3ee89b017b69e97dee4f0a15704c27bf7897fc:5

value
34137559
script pubkey
OP_0 OP_PUSHBYTES_20 eb64a7f7152b323ca5399ce568137b936a2bbc09
address
bc1qadj20ac49vereffennjksymmjd4zh0qfqfpg0u
transaction
89b4e7c45ca8c161d9b7ed631d3ee89b017b69e97dee4f0a15704c27bf7897fc